This fall, the Roslyn Walking Tour guided participants along Main Street and East Broadway, exploring the rich architectural history that defines the village. Highlights included a stop in Gerry Park to visit the Mackay Horse Statue and uncover its fascinating story, along with a visit to the historic Van Nostrand–Starkins House, dating back to 1680. The tour also highlighted Roslyn’s significant religious landmarks, focusing on the village’s historic churches situated along Main Street and East Broadway. The experience concluded with a must-see visit to the Roslyn Grist Mill, where restoration and preservation efforts continue to bring this treasured site back to life.
